Responsibilities

Conduct Criticality Screening and Risk Analysis to identify critical equipment and Balance of Plant (BOP) equipment.
Champion and implement Asset Strategies in alignment with equipment criticality and business needs.
Support the development and execution of the 3-year Reliability Improvement Plan, including Asset Availability performance history and improvement goals related to Equipment Reliability.
Select the appropriate Risk Management Strategy or Alternative Failure Management Strategy and develop/implement Equipment Maintenance Strategies (EMS’s) for each piece of critical equipment and generic EMSs for BOP equipment.
Support PPM Coordinator for reviews of existing plans for effectiveness and applicability based on the Risk Management Strategy, Alternative Failure Management Strategy, vendor information, RCM tools, historical equipment reliability issues, results of PPM, etc.
Evaluate/implement available Equipment Condition Monitoring techniques and new technology to improve productivity, effectiveness, and the value of the equipment condition monitoring program.
Support PPM Coordinator to ensure that documentation of findings of PPM and Corrective Maintenance activities are properly documented in CMMS so that evaluations can be done.
Routinely monitor Asset Reliability, maintenance data, PPM results, significant reliability events, RCA findings, maintenance histories, and production loss data.
Analyze production loss accounting data and cost data to develop and prioritize a list of reliability opportunities.
Facilitate Root Cause Analysis and RCM studies, utilizing reliability engineering tools such as Weibull and FMEA, for events that meet the incident triggers. Implement effective corrective actions/improvements.
Perform value engineering activities for projects, design, Reliability/Maintenance input, PMs, BOMs, equipment selection, criticality, etc.
Ensure new equipment is integrated into appropriate systems, tools, processes, strategies, etc. prior to being put into Service.
Perform periodic gap assessments between the Asset Reliability Plan, Equipment Maintenance Strategies, and PPM plans to identify gaps vs. current reliability performance, cost, and asset availability. Identify and implement corrective actions/improvements to eliminate low-value PPM (e.g., extend intervals between PPM) or other work while effectively managing risk in terms of mechanical integrity, EHS, production, maintenance cost, etc.
Implement periodic plant equipment/facility audits to proactively monitor plant condition and prevent unplanned deterioration of assets.
Support PPM Coordinator to optimize spare parts/equipment inventory.
Champion the use of the Management of Change process for changes, modifications, deletions to equipment, materials, parts, consumables, and related Operating Discipline.
